A Resolution designating the week of January 18 through 25, 2026, as "Dr. Martin Luther King, Jr., Holiday Week" in Pennsylvania.

Summary

The Senate adopted a resolution naming the week of January 18 through 25, 2026, as "Dr. Martin Luther King, Jr., Holiday Week" in Pennsylvania. It calls on all Pennsylvanians to remember King's commitment to non‑violent activism and equality. The measure is purely symbolic and does not create any new programs or funding requirements.
